Sewer Line Replacement cost: Baton Rouge vs New Orleans (2026)
In 2026, sewer line replacement is about 1% less expensive in Baton Rouge than in New Orleans. Most homeowners pay around $7,200 in Baton Rouge versus $7,300 in New Orleans — a gap of roughly $100.

Baton Rouge vs New Orleans: full breakdown
| Factor | Baton Rouge | New Orleans |
|---|---|---|
| Typical 2026 cost | $7,200 | $7,300 |
| Estimated range | $3,000–$11,400 | $3,050–$11,550 |
| Labor index (vs US) | ×0.95 | ×0.96 |
| Climate zone | Hot | Hot |
| Climate factor | ×0.98 | ×0.98 |
| Local permit | $225 | $225 |
| Labor share | $4,300 | $4,400 |
| Materials/equipment | $2,900 | $2,900 |
Localized 2026 planning estimates — not quotes. Each city adjusts the national sewer line replacement range for local labor, climate and permits.
